How many beers is equivalent to a fifth of vodka?

If the rum is 40\% alcohol by volume (abv), it contains 10.24 ounces of alcohol. A 12-ounce bottle of 5\% abv lager would contain 0.6 oz. of alcohol. Therefore you would need [(10.24/0.6)*12] = about 204 ounces (17.06 12-ounce bottles) of 5\% a.b.v. lager to equal the alcohol content of a fifth of 80-proof rum.

How many beers is a shot of vodka equal to?

One standard bottle of beer (12 oz) is equal to a single US shot of vodka (1.48 oz). This means that for every shot of vodka you take, you are effectively consuming the same amount of alcohol in one beer. Vodka with a proof above 80 will have more alcohol, however, and potentially be equal to 1.5-2.5 beers per shot.

How many beers are in a 750ml bottle of vodka?

A Fifth of Liquor Now, the 750-ml bottles are technically a metric fifth, which is 1 percent smaller than its Imperial counterpart. That being said, what you really need to know is that mixed drinks have a 1.5-ounce (45 ml) serving of liquor per drink, so a 750-ml bottle of liquor will make about 16 drinks.

Is a fifth of vodka a lot?

A fifth of vodka is equal in size to a standard bottle of wine, though it is much more potent. Drinking a fifth of vodka every day is not just unhealthy, it’s downright dangerous. A fifth contains about 17 shots of vodka, which is a least eight times the recommended daily alcohol consumption limit.

How many shots are in a fifth of vodka?

17
How Many Shots Are in a Fifth? A fifth usually refers to a 750 ml or 25.4-ounce bottle. This size bottle contains just over 17 1.5-ounce shots.

Is vodka worse for your liver than beer?

Myth 3: Drinking hard liquor is worse than drinking beer or wine. The type of alcohol you drink doesn’t make a difference – it’s all about how much of it you drink. “The safe limit is fixed at 14 units a week,” explains Dr Lui. “Below this limit, alcoholic fatty liver is less likely to occur.

How many drinks is a fifth of vodka?

There are 25.36 ounces in a fifth of liquor. That means there are approximately 17 1.5-ounce drinks in a fifth.

How much vodka does it take to get drunk?

As a very rough rule of thumb, a healthy adult processes alcohol at about 10 ml per hour. 300 ml of vodka typically contains about 120 ml of alcohol. So if you spread it over 5 hours, by the end you’ll ‘only’ be as drunk as if you’d consumed 70 ml of alcohol. 70 ml amounts to a blood alcohol content of about 0.13, whereas 120 ml is more like 0.22.

What is more harmful – beer or vodka?

When asked what is more harmful, beer or vodka, the answer is the following: the harm and benefits are determined by the amount of alcohol consumed, not by the beverage itself. A healthy person can drink both beer and vodka in moderate amounts. A safe beer dose is not more than 0.1 gl/0.5 liters per day.
